I have had so much trouble trying to find a decent nursing bra; no one makes my size (32D) even in a regular bra, so all of mine are either too big or too small. So I decided to bite the bullet and shop online for a really good nursing bra, no matter what it cost! I found the Bravado Original Nursing Bra, which seemed really good because the sizing is small-medium-large instead of actual cup sizes, so finding my size was pretty much goof-proof. I wasn't crazy about spending $40 on one bra, but I was desperate for something that actually fits.
So I open the package and I must admit...its not much to look at. Okay its downright ugly, a grandma bra. But I decided to put it on anyway. It slips on like a sports bra, and it looks really cute on. And it actually fits perfectly!!! Its really supportive and comfortable, and my posture is so much better with this bra on. Oooo Lordy, what a bra!
And now the con (why must there always be a con?): the flaps open and close with a snap, which is quite difficult to do with one hand. Time will tell if the snap will be a little less stiff once it breaks in. Otherwise, I absolutely love this bra and feel it is worth every penny..so I ordered 3 more!
